STC Improvement Calculator
The STC Improvement Calculator estimates the Sound Transmission Class rating improvement when adding BlastBlock MLV to your existing wall, ceiling, or floor assembly. Enter your current assembly type and the BlastBlock product you are considering to receive an estimated total assembly STC rating.
Understanding STC benchmarks: STC 25 — loud speech clearly audible; STC 33 — typical interior drywall partition; STC 40 — loud speech heard but not understood; STC 50 — very loud sounds faintly audible; STC 60+ — professional recording studio standard. Adding BB830 to a standard drywall partition typically improves STC from 33 to 45–50. BB830LF in a double-leaf assembly reaches STC 60–70.
This is a planning estimation tool. Actual installed performance depends on installation quality, perimeter sealing, flanking paths through the structure, and the presence of other weak points such as doors, windows, and penetrations. Material Area Calculator
The Material Area Calculator determines exactly how many square meters of BlastBlock MLV you need. Enter the dimensions of each surface — walls, ceiling, floor — and the calculator provides the total coverage area plus a recommended order quantity that includes a 10% overage allowance for seam overlaps, cuts, and waste.
BlastBlock BB830 is supplied in rolls of 1000mm × 5000mm (5 m² per roll). BB830LF and BB460 are available in standard roll formats. Seam overlaps should be a minimum of 50mm (2 inches), meaning approximately 5–10% extra material is needed beyond the bare surface area. The calculator accounts for this automatically in its recommended quantity output.
How to Use These Calculators Effectively
- Measure all surfaces you plan to treat, including the full height of walls from floor to ceiling
- Subtract window and door areas from wall measurements — MLV is not installed over openings
- Add 10% to the calculated area for seam overlaps and waste from cuts
- For acoustic sealant (BA890), estimate one cartridge per 5–8 linear meters of perimeter sealing
- For putty pads (BA650), count one pad per electrical outlet or switch box
